The Fast and Reliable T3
A T3 Line in Rhode Island is very fast and reliable. It is used for full duplex
use. Normally large corporations or medium to large-sized businesses,
governments, medical facilities, telecommunication companies,
and Internet Services Providers use a T3 Line or multiple T3s.
T3s are usually more of cost effective alternative to multiple
T1 lines. A T3 is normally used for the flexibility and scalibility
of their transmission of data. The T3 Line high speed transfer
rate may be used with the mix of voice, data, internet, or multimedia
(video, images, streaming).

Information about Rhode Island
From its beginnings, Rhode Island has been distinguished by its
support for freedom of conscience and action: Clergyman Roger Williams
founded the present state capital, Providence, after being exiled
by the Massachusetts Bay Colony Puritans in 1636. Williams was followed
by other religious exiles who founded Pocasset, now Portsmouth,
in 1638 and Newport in 1639.
Rhode Island's rebellious, authority-defying nature was further
demonstrated by the burnings of the British revenue cutters Liberty
and Gaspee prior to the Revolution; by its early declaration of
independence from Great Britain in May 1776; by its refusal to participate
actively in the War of 1812; and by Dorr's Rebellion of 1842, which
protested property requirements for voting.
